The annual Malofiej Awards for Infographics were organized by the Spanish chapter of the Society for News Design (SND-E) for accomplishments in journalistic infographics. [1] They have been regarded as some of the most prestigious in this field. [2] [3] The awards were given each March in Pamplona, Spain.
Submissions were invited online. [4]
On October 1, 2021, the organizers announced [5] that the awards would be paused “while we open a period of reflection to think about how to continue with them in the future.”
The awards are named for Argentine designer Alejandro Malofiej, who made simple and creative graphics. [6]
The Malofiej were an essential reference for their prestige and drawing power. The Awards, considered to be the Pulitzers for infographics, [1] the professional workshop “Show, Don’t Tell!” and the Conference in Pamplona annually bring together the best infographics artists from media (newspapers, magazines, agencies) from around the world.
